Democratic Republic of the Congo - Gross fixed capital formation in constant prices of 2015

30,028,097,725 (US dollars) in 2022

In 2022, real gross fixed capital formation for Democratic Republic of the Congo was 30,028 million US dollars. Though Democratic Republic of the Congo real gross fixed capital formation fluctuated substantially in recent years, it tended to increase through 1973 - 2022 period ending at 30,028 million US dollars in 2022.

What is real gross fixed capital formation?

Gross fixed capital formation is measured by the total value of a producer’s acquisitions, less disposals, of fixed assets during the accounting period plus certain additions to the value of non- produced assets (such as subsoil assets or major improvements in the quantity, quality or productivity of land) realised by the productive activity of institutional units.
